Report: Former Penn State Football Running Back Tikey Hayes Transfers To Nebraska

Former Penn State football running back Tikey Hayes is set to commit to Nebraska, per Sean Callahan of HuskerOnline.
He has four years of eligibility remaining.
Hayes appeared in just one game as a Nittany Lion after joining the team as part of its 2025 recruiting class. He rushed for 18 yards on three carries in Penn State’s Pinstripe Bowl victory over Clemson last season, splitting carries with Quinton Martin Jr. and Corey Smith.
Hayes transferred to Iowa Western Community College in May 2026 after announcing that he would not return to Happy Valley for the upcoming season. He was set to be the starter for the Reivers before deciding to make the jump back to the Big Ten.
The running back committed to Penn State in September 2023, carrying four-star status. In Hayes’ junior season at Aliquippa High School in Aliquippa, Pennsylvania, he recorded 450 yards on 56 carries over just 3 games, averaging 8.0 yards per carry. He also tallied four touchdowns over that span, according to his MaxPreps profile.
Hayes will join Penn State letterman and former linebacker Matt Rhule, who developed the Big Ten’s leading rusher in 2025, Emmett Johnson.
